Subject: Pilot Update — Quillmark Stores

Executive team,

The eight-store pilot with Quillmark is confirmed for Q2. Finance: pilot costs run through the Larkspur cost center, capped per the approved budget, with weekly reconciliation. Success metrics are sell-through and return rate. The strategic intent behind this pilot is set out below.

board note of tadup-tajog: Headcount on the Oliiel team goes from 31 to 88 by the end of February. Gross margin on Oliiel came in at 62 percent against a plan of 29 percent.

## Runbook: session-token refresh loop

When Lanternly clients refresh tokens faster than once per minute, the Osgood gateway is likely rejecting signatures after a rotation. Confirm the gateway and issuer share the same epoch via `/introspect`. If they disagree, redeploy the issuer with an updated env file; the current signing secret belongs on the next line.

vault entry, yahif-yajep: COURIER_KEY29=b802bdf8034096b65a51c6ba5abe2

Management Meeting Minutes — Inventory Write-Down

Attendees: regional ops, finance lead.

Agreed: obsolete Fenwick-line stock written down by 430K this quarter. Branch managers to complete physical counts by the 20th. Discounted clearance runs through outlet channels only. Finance will restate branch targets accordingly. The related confidential planning note follows below.

internal memo for yahaf-hawif: The finance team signed off on a budget of $59.9 million for Project Rusax.